diff options
author | Jacob Hayes <jacob.r.hayes@gmail.com> | 2017-12-15 09:56:59 -0500 |
---|---|---|
committer | Mike Bayer <mike_mp@zzzcomputing.com> | 2017-12-18 11:33:09 -0500 |
commit | 756d5782870029f2d97b1aa171abd61dbf4cbcb4 (patch) | |
tree | 3dac92daa83fd7e2dcdacb858e43d0fef4e547ec /lib/sqlalchemy/dialects/postgresql/base.py | |
parent | 19e13cf3d203b59ad285ab0193cb9fc53c4fcff2 (diff) | |
download | sqlalchemy-756d5782870029f2d97b1aa171abd61dbf4cbcb4.tar.gz |
Add TRUNCATE to postgres autocommit regexp
Extends AUTOCOMMIT_REGEXP for the postgres dialect to include `TRUNCATE`.
Change-Id: I315e03674b89bb89aae669b8655481e4d890491e
Pull-request: https://github.com/zzzeek/sqlalchemy/pull/407
Diffstat (limited to 'lib/sqlalchemy/dialects/postgresql/base.py')
-rw-r--r-- | lib/sqlalchemy/dialects/postgresql/base.py |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/lib/sqlalchemy/dialects/postgresql/base.py b/lib/sqlalchemy/dialects/postgresql/base.py index 043efd6df..f11604259 100644 --- a/lib/sqlalchemy/dialects/postgresql/base.py +++ b/lib/sqlalchemy/dialects/postgresql/base.py @@ -925,7 +925,7 @@ from sqlalchemy.types import INTEGER, BIGINT, SMALLINT, VARCHAR, \ AUTOCOMMIT_REGEXP = re.compile( r'\s*(?:UPDATE|INSERT|CREATE|DELETE|DROP|ALTER|GRANT|REVOKE|' - 'IMPORT FOREIGN SCHEMA|REFRESH MATERIALIZED VIEW)', + 'IMPORT FOREIGN SCHEMA|REFRESH MATERIALIZED VIEW|TRUNCATE)', re.I | re.UNICODE) RESERVED_WORDS = set( |